OSU students gather to remember Virginia Tech Victims

Thousands of Ohio State University students gathered at the OSU oval Wednesday afternoon to remember the victims of this week's shooting at Virginia Tech.

The students wore maroon and orange ribbons, signed a message board. They stood silently while the Orton Hall chimes played the Virginia Tech alma mater and an OSU marching band member played taps.
